| | 1-Tetralone Basic information |
| Product Name: | 1-Tetralone | | Synonyms: | KETOTETRAHYDRONAPHTHALENE;1,2,3,4-TETRAHYDRO-1-NAPHTHALENONE;1-TETRALONE;3,4-DIHYDRO-1-(2H)NAPHTHALENEONE;1,2,3,4-Tetrahydro-1-oxonaphthalene;1-Tetralone,97%;1(2H)-Naphthalenone, 3,4-dihydro-;à-Tetralone | | CAS: | 529-34-0 | | MF: | C10H10O | | MW: | 146.19 | | EINECS: | 208-460-6 | | Product Categories: | Bioactive Small Molecules;Building Blocks;C10;Carbonyl Compounds;Cell Biology;Chemical Synthesis;PHARMACEUTICAL INTERMEDIATES;Ketones;Organic Building Blocks;T;Cardiovascular & Blood System Agents;pharmaceutical;bc0001;529-34-0 | | Mol File: | 529-34-0.mol |  |
| | 1-Tetralone Chemical Properties |
| Melting point | 2-7 °C(lit.) | | Boiling point | 113-116 °C6 mm Hg(lit.) | | density | 1.099 g/mL at 25 °C(lit.) | | refractive index | n20/D 1.568(lit.) | | Fp | >230 °F | | storage temp. | 2-8°C | | solubility | Chloroform, Ethyl Acetate (Slightly) | | form | Liquid | | color | brown | | Water Solubility | insoluble | | BRN | 607374 | | InChI | 1S/C10H10O/c11-10-7-3-5-8-4-1-2-6-9(8)10/h1-2,4,6H,3,5,7H2 | | InChIKey | XHLHPRDBBAGVEG-UHFFFAOYSA-N | | SMILES | O=C1CCCc2ccccc12 | | CAS DataBase Reference | 529-34-0(CAS DataBase Reference) | | NIST Chemistry Reference | 1(2H)-Naphthalenone, 3,4-dihydro-(529-34-0) | | EPA Substance Registry System | 1,2,3,4-Tetrahydronaphthalen-1-one (529-34-0) |
| Hazard Codes | Xn | | Risk Statements | 22-20/22-20/21/22 | | Safety Statements | 23-24/25-36 | | WGK Germany | 3 | | RTECS | QK4375000 | | TSCA | TSCA listed | | HS Code | 29143900 | | Storage Class | 10 - Combustible liquids | | Hazard Classifications | Acute Tox. 4 Oral | | Hazardous Substances Data | 529-34-0(Hazardous Substances Data) | | Toxicity | LD50 orally in Rabbit: 810 mg/kg LD50 dermal Rabbit > 2200 mg/kg |
| | 1-Tetralone Usage And Synthesis |
| Chemical Properties | Clear amber to brown oily liquid | | Uses | 1-Tetralone is a reagent used in the synthesis of amino-pyrazolopyridines with anti-NF-κB and pro-apoptotic potential. | | Production Methods | Intramolecular acylation of 4-phenylbutyric acid to 1,2,3,4-tetrahydronaphthalen-1-one (1-Tetralone).
 | | Synthesis Reference(s) | Tetrahedron Letters, 32, p. 4291, 1991 DOI: 10.1016/S0040-4039(00)92151-8 | | Purification Methods | Check the IR first. Purify α-tetralone by dissolving 20mL in Et2O (200mL), washing with H2O (100mL), 5% aqueous NaOH (100mL), H2O (100mL), 3% aqueous AcOH (100mL), 5% NaHCO3 (100mL) then H2O (100mL) and dry the ethereal layer over MgSO4. Filter, evaporate and fractionate the residue through a 6in Vigreux column (p 11) under reduced pressure to give a colourless oil (~17g) with b 90-91o/0.50.7mm. [Snyder & Werber Org Synth Coll Vol III 798 1955.] It has also been fractionated through a 0.5metre packed column with a heated jacket under reflux using a partial take-off head. It has max 247.5 and 290nm (hexane). The phenylhydrazone has m 83o. The 2,4,6-trinitrophenylhydrazone has m 247.5-248o (from EtOH). [Olson & Bader Org Synth Coll Vol IV 898 1963, Beilstein 7 H 370, 7 III 1416, 7 IV 1015.] |
